This full-day tour takes you to the park’s must-see destinations, with convenient pickup and drop-off in Calgary, Canmore, or Banff. ◆ Summer season (June to mid-October), our itinerary will include Moraine Lake, Lake Louise, Banff Town, and Johnston. ◆ Winter season (mid-October to May), our itinerary will include Lake Louise, Johnston canyon, Banff Town, Bow Falls and Surprise Corner. Kindly refer to the tour reminder we send out the day before departure for the finalized itinerary. Throughout the tour, our experienced guides will help you capture incredible photos, ensuring you leave with unforgettable memories of Banff’s most spectacular locations.

Moraine Lake
This destination is only visited from (1/6/2026-12/10/2026, weather permitting). During other seasons, we will visit Bow Falls, Surprise Corner and Banff Town. Moraine Lake is a stunning glacial lake in Banff National Park, famous for its vibrant turquoise waters and breathtaking mountain backdrop. Surrounded by the Valley of the Ten Peaks, it offers incredible views, scenic hiking trails, and a peaceful atmosphere. A must-visit destination for nature lovers and photographers!
60 minutes here · Admission included

Johnston Canyon
Nestled within the heart of Banff National Park, Johnston Canyon offers travelers a remarkable experience. They will witness the canyon's striking beauty with cascading waterfalls, turquoise pools, and towering cliffs. Hiking along well-maintained trails, crossing suspended bridges, and immersing in nature's splendor await adventurous explorers.
60 minutes here
